Video Type
Here the type of the video can be chosen between analog video input or digital H.264 stream
over Ethernet:
·
Analog Video Input
One of the device's analog video inputs shall be used (select which with Video Camera
property below)
·
Ethernet Stream
Show a video stream received via Ethernet (see below for requirements and limitations)
Stream Type
Here the type of the Ethernet camera stream can be chosen:
·
H.264 via UDP/RTP
·
MJPEG via UDP/RTP
·
H.264 via RTSP
UDP Port
If the Video Type was set to Ethernet stream and a Stream Type with UDP protocol was
selected, the UDP port used by the camera can be configured here.
RTSP URL
If the Video Type was set to Ethernet stream and a Stream Type with RTSP protocol was
selected, the RTSP URL can be written here.
The typical URL for Axis cameras is: rtsp://user:password@<IP>/axis-media/media.amp (e.g.
rtsp://root:root@192.168.135.90/axis-media/media.amp)
Anonymous viewing can be enabled in the camera settings. Then user:pass@ can be
omitted.
Please check the camera documentation for correct url.
Video Rotation
The camera image can be displayed rotated in 90° steps. This is useful if the camera is e.g.
mounted sideways. Please note that an automatic rotation is added when running the device
in portrait orientation.
Note the camera preview image changes with different rotation settings.
Video Camera
This property only has an effect if Video Type is set to Analog Video Input. Select one of
the 3 video inputs of the device.
